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39322243309 6186788134 11472467 1385927 4147301665
171 9592946 962
171 9592946 962
9933 472291 34703436985 24
All about undefined
Interested in learning more?
171 9592946 962
9933 472291 34703436985 24
See more
36698282 25
57253 81 35021 777689932 900397766
See more
5302496 12905 99377641
830 9246 556
See more